    WPPN (106.7 FM) is a radio station licensed to Des Plaines, Illinois, that targets the Chicago metropolitan area.WPPN broadcasts a Spanish AC format. WPPN is owned by TelevisaUnivision through its Uforia Audio Network subsidiary.

    WMJX (106.7 FM) – branded Magic 106.7 – is a commercial adult contemporary radio station licensed to Boston, Massachusetts. Owned by Audacy, Inc. , the station serves Greater Boston and much of surrounding New England .

    The co-founder of Boston Women in Media & Entertainment from 2012 to 2020, she spent 25 years on the air at WMJX, Magic 106.7, and is the creator of the station's signature public affairs program Exceptional Women. O'Terry has been profiled in the book: Boston Inspirational Women by Bill and Kerry Brett.
